About the Role

The primary purpose of this position is to: serve as an Attorney-Advisor in the Air Combat Command (ACC) Office of the Staff Judge Advocate.

What You'll Do

  • Provides legal advice to ACC clients concerning ACC Future Total Force (FTF) basing concepts and operational concepts.
  • Serves as primary legal advisor to ACC clients on questions related to Total Force (TF) planning and implementation of basing and operational concepts with a particular emphasis on preserving unity of command within the confines of the US Constitution and the Uniform Code of Military Justice (UCMJ).
  • Provides full spectrum legal advice to ACC clients on entire breadth of complex legal issues related to TF basing and operational concepts with a special emphasis on preserving unity of command and the UCMJ.
  • Negotiates with representatives of the Air Force Reserve Command, the National Guard Bureau, and state government authorities.
  • Reviews classified and unclassified documents including baseline surveys, basing agreements, operational planning documents, and concept papers and provides well-reasoned, responsive legal opinions based on these reviews.
  • ACC's primary legal advisor on evaluating the constitutionality of basing concepts and ensuring operational concepts comply with federal law, to include the UCMJ.
  • Collaborates with legislative liaisons to draft new or change existing legislation that enables implementation of the Air force TF integration policy.
  • Writes legal opinions on extremely complex and difficult legal questions related to novel basing concepts applying applicable legal authority to allow the Air Force to substantially broaden their global war fighting mission.
  • Drafts and negotiates TF association plans (APlans), memorandums of agreement (MOAs), memorandums of understanding (MOUs), in support of component integration using understanding of the potential impact of relevant legal authorities on Air Force global missions, ACC installations, ACC operations, state and national guard operations, and all related legal implications.

Requirements

  • Must be a graduate of a law school accredited by the American Bar Association, and be currently licensed as an attorney, in active (or equivalent) status and in good standing, with the bar of a U.S. state, territory, or commonwealth.
  • The attorney must maintain such bar membership in at least one jurisdiction during the entire course of employment with the Air Force.
